The station is equipped with a ticket office open from early morning to late evening, ensuring you have ample time to plan your journey. Conveniently, ticket machines are available for quick purchases and collections, but they may not be accessible for everyone, so please plan accordingly. While smartcards cannot be issued or validated here, traditional ticket options are efficiently managed.
Help is readily available with staff present during office hours. They offer guidance not only from the ticket office but also from strategically placed help points. If you need any assistance, don't hesitate to ask; staff support is consistent throughout the week. The station is fitted with an induction loop for hearing-impaired travelers but does lack certain amenities like accessible toilets and baby changing facilities.
While there is a step-free aspect, almost none of the platforms grant step-free access, thus categorizing the station as a Category C in terms of accessibility. However, on-board conductors offer assistance. For travelers with limited mobility, planning and perhaps arranging help in advance could make your journey smoother. Extensive parking, including 36 free spots and 3 accessible spaces, is available all day, every day.
Dudley Port station's location offers convenient access to several transport links. In scenarios where rail services are replaced, buses operate from the bus stops on A461, ensuring your journeys remain uninterrupted. Taxis can also be quickly hailed or booked from local services, with two reliable providers offering their services. Furthermore, downloadable information for local bus services is available to help map out your onward journeys.

While Slaithwaite Station may not offer a ticket office, there are convenient ticket machines available to collect your pre-purchased tickets. Even if you're looking to travel with a smartcard, you'll find these are issued at the station, though they lack validators. Accessibility is somewhat limited; step-free access is available but only on select routes. For those requiring extra assistance, it's best to contact the helpline or speak with the on-train conductor. Remember, boarding ramps are available to ensure ease of access. Despite the absence of a waiting room or accessible toilets, there is seating available and free parking around the clock though not equipped with CCTV.
Slaithwaite offers a variety of onward travel connections. Rail replacement buses can be picked up on the A62, which will take you either towards Huddersfield or Manchester, depending on which side you embark from. Taxis can be arranged through local services, with bookings accessible via Cab4You. Getting around by bus is straightforward with information readily available at Busline (0871 200 2233). For those searching for underground or metro connections, WYPTE (0113 245 7676) can be a helpful resource, although these services aren’t available directly from the station itself.
